Canada - Agriculture Value Added
Since 2014, Canada Agriculture Value Added jumped by 3.8points year on year. With 2.04 Percent of Total Value Added in 2019, the country was ranked number 145 comparing other countries in Agriculture Value Added. Canada is overtaken by South Africa, which was ranked number 144 at 2.12 Percent of Total Value Added and is followed by Iraq with 2 Percent of Total Value Added. Sierra Leone topped the ranking with 59.92 Percent of Total Value Added in 2019, a fall of 1.8points versus 2018. Guinea-Bissau, Chad and Mali resp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Oman witnessed the best average annual growth at +15.1points per year, while Iraq witnessed the worst performance at -16.4points per year.
